How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Tempe?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Tempe Studio Apartments | $1,509 | $699 | $4,917 |
Tempe 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,668 | $868 | $8,088 |
Tempe 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,053 | $950 | $8,300 |
Tempe 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,533 | $840 | $9,633 |
Tempe 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,568 | $650 | $10,000+ |
